解构网站逻辑:缓存驱动的高级交互体验设计
|
在现代网页设计中,用户对交互体验的要求越来越高。传统的页面加载方式往往导致延迟和卡顿,影响用户体验。为了解决这个问题,缓存驱动的设计理念逐渐成为提升交互性能的重要手段。 缓存的核心在于减少重复请求,提高数据访问速度。当用户首次访问某个页面时,系统会将关键数据和资源存储在本地或服务器端的缓存中。这样,在后续访问时,可以直接从缓存中获取信息,避免了不必要的网络请求。 这种设计不仅提升了响应速度,还减轻了服务器负担。对于频繁访问的内容,如导航栏、用户资料等,使用缓存可以显著降低加载时间,使界面更加流畅。 然而,缓存并非万能。如果缓存策略不合理,可能导致用户看到过时的信息,影响信任度。因此,合理的缓存更新机制至关重要。例如,设置合理的过期时间,或者根据用户行为动态刷新缓存内容。 在实际应用中,开发者可以通过多种技术实现缓存驱动的交互。比如使用浏览器的LocalStorage或SessionStorage,或者借助服务端的Redis等缓存数据库。同时,前端框架也提供了内置的缓存管理功能,简化了开发流程。 除了性能优化,缓存还能增强用户的感知体验。当用户操作后,界面能够迅速反馈,让用户感觉更直观、更高效。这种即时性是现代Web应用不可或缺的一部分。
AI提供的信息图,仅供参考 站长个人见解,缓存驱动的设计不仅是技术上的选择,更是用户体验的体现。通过合理利用缓存,可以打造更快速、更智能的交互体验,满足用户日益增长的需求。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

